Albania's Rama lashes out at 'flamingo' protesters, calling them idiots
Albanian Prime Minister Edi Rama has attacked protesters opposing a luxury resort backed by Donald Trump's son-in-law Jared Kushner, calling them idiots.

Albanian Prime Minister Edi Rama has harshly criticized protesters who are demonstrating against a luxury resort project backed by Donald Trump's son-in-law, Jared Kushner. Rama referred to the protesters, whom local media have dubbed 'flamingo' protesters, as idiots. The demonstrations are the largest political protests in Albania's recent history and are directed against the planned development on an unspoiled coastline. The European Union has warned Albania that its handling of the situation could affect the country's path to EU membership. Meanwhile, Iran has denied any involvement in the protests, which have led to accusations of disinformation between Tehran and Tirana.
